Output d3aed139652d3a54150d1b20df21faa2e4dd66ed4438380c5adc50b0bb3bfcfc:1

value
996913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cddb266db227e28d1867d3711d9d553f2e98409f OP_EQUAL
address
3LTUygiqsySoZjrmtEBGSNaPHh8V1hGCaM
transaction
d3aed139652d3a54150d1b20df21faa2e4dd66ed4438380c5adc50b0bb3bfcfc
confirmations
317030
spent
true